JL Hutton is a scholar working on Pediatrics, Perinatology and Child Health, Surgery and Obstetrics and Gynecology. According to data from OpenAlex, JL Hutton has authored 11 papers receiving a total of 343 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Pediatrics, Perinatology and Child Health, 3 papers in Surgery and 3 papers in Obstetrics and Gynecology. Recurrent topics in JL Hutton's work include Pregnancy and preeclampsia studies (2 papers), Birth, Development, and Health (2 papers) and Neonatal Respiratory Health Research (2 papers). JL Hutton is often cited by papers focused on Pregnancy and preeclampsia studies (2 papers), Birth, Development, and Health (2 papers) and Neonatal Respiratory Health Research (2 papers). JL Hutton collaborates with scholars based in United Kingdom, Sweden and Italy. JL Hutton's co-authors include Sarah E Lamb, J. Lawrence Marsh, Karla Hemming, Anthony G Marson, Nathalie Jetté, Michael Clark, Scott Wilson, Ala Szczepura, Jeremy Dale and L Rosenbloom and has published in prestigious journals such as The Lancet, Cochrane Database of Systematic Reviews and BJOG An International Journal of Obstetrics & Gynaecology.
